What in the Inheritance Heck is Probate Court?

Probate court, my friend, is basically the legal referee for the sometimes messy game of "who gets grandma's prized porcelain cat collection?". When someone shuffles off this mortal coil (sorry, but gotta be blunt), their stuff (fancy legal term: estate) needs to be sorted and distributed. That's where probate court steps in, ensuring everything is above board and that nobody walks away with more than their fair share of grandma's, ahem, unique taste in feline figurines.

Think of it as the executor's (the person in charge of the estate) trusty sidekick, making sure they dot their i's and cross their t's while navigating the legalities of inheritance.

But Do I REALLY Need to Deal with Probate Court?

Hold on to your hats (or wigs, depending on your inheritance windfall), probate court isn't always mandatory. Here's the skinny:

  • If there's a will: Generally, yes, probate court is involved to ensure the will is legit and followed correctly.
  • If there's no will and the estate is small: Georgia allows for a less formal process called "beneficiary collection" for estates under a certain value. Think of it as the express lane of inheritance.

Bottom line: Check with a lawyer (yes, a real one, not your neighbor who once watched a legal drama) to see if probate court is your destiny.
